TX-SEN: James Talarico Raised $2.5 Million After Stephen Colbert Interview Was Shifted From Broadcast To YouTube [View all]

The attention surrounding James Talarico‘s Late Show with Stephen Colbert interview has been very good for the Texas Democrat’s campaign for U.S. Senate.

He raised $2.5 million in the 24 hours after the segment was shifted from CBS broadcast to YouTube, his largest single fundraising period for the campaign.

On Monday, Colbert said that he was prohibited from featuring Talarico on his late-night show, as the FCC has issued new guidance about the appearance of political candidates on talk shows.

Instead, Colbert said that the interview would be posted on YouTube. There, the interview has drawn almost 5.2 million views, greatly exceeding the show’s average broadcast audience.
